To remove restrictions from a parcel of land in Paducah, Kentucky.

Energy and Natural Resources Committee, Natural Resources Committee · Rep. James Comer (R-KY)

7 August 2026  |  Passed Senate (unanimous consent)

What's next: Presidential review (±10 days)

Summary: The bill would direct the Department of the Interior to remove various deed restrictions from a parcel of land at a military reserve center in Paducah, Kentucky that was transferred to the city in 2012, freeing it from easements, reservations, and other conditions that currently limit its use.
